PRO - Core PrinciplesPRO - Core Principles
The Ten CommandmentsThe Ten Commandments
1.1. Uniqueness - a certificate is uniqueUniqueness - a certificate is unique2.2. Ownership - account holders own certificatesOwnership - account holders own certificates3.3. Operational reliabilityOperational reliability4.4. Protection of Account HoldersProtection of Account Holders5.5. GovernanceGovernance6.6. Access & TransparencyAccess & Transparency7.7. Cost EffectivenessCost Effectiveness8.8. CommunicationsCommunications9.9. Regulation & OversightRegulation & Oversight10.10. RecordsRecords

Summary of ActivitySummary of Activity
Since 2001Since 2001 20052005
IssuedIssued 120,729,014120,729,014 47,934,20647,934,206
ExportedExported 33,200,27533,200,275 13,690,44013,690,440
RedeemedRedeemed 59,522,70159,522,701 24,753,05524,753,055
(source AIB statistics report: 5 March 2006)
